David Bailey, a revolutionary fashion and social photographer from the ‘60s, famously said, “It takes a lot of imagination to be a good photographer. You need less imagination to be a painter because you can invent things. But in photography everything is so ordinary, it takes a lot of looking before you learn to see the extraordinary…”.
But as David Bailey told us back in the ‘60s, “If you are not looking, you won’t see.”
